Output 32de66397203683ccfc52d5b8a0391db2d450de86dd08061b0730433528ab362:49

value
2410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f7c3c18e4eb3125d24e7df065325da06de475a OP_EQUAL
address
3Mk6iYcT9gci8d835XeRNxZnjJnPQtgn1i
transaction
32de66397203683ccfc52d5b8a0391db2d450de86dd08061b0730433528ab362
spent
true